About Cryptocurrency Tax Advisor
A Cryptocurrency Tax Advisor helps individuals and businesses understand and manage the tax and reporting implications of cryptocurrency activity. In practical terms, that often includes organizing transaction history, calculating gains/losses, classifying income (trading vs. business income, mining, staking, airdrops), and preparing tax-ready summaries for filing.
You typically need a Cryptocurrency Tax Advisor when your transaction count grows, you used multiple exchanges/wallets, you moved funds internationally, or you need documentation that stands up to scrutiny (banking, audits, business bookkeeping, or investor due diligence).
Average cost in Algiers: Not publicly stated. Pricing commonly depends on the number of transactions, complexity (DeFi/NFTs), and whether the work includes reconciliation, reporting, and ongoing advisory.
Licensing / certifications: Not publicly stated as a single standard specifically for “crypto tax” in Algiers. Tax services are generally delivered by qualified accountants, chartered accountants, or tax consultants (titles and requirements can vary). For crypto-specific work, practical experience with transaction tracing and documentation is often more important than a label.

Cost of Hiring a Cryptocurrency Tax Advisor in Algiers
Average price range: Not publicly stated. In practice, crypto tax work is usually priced based on scope rather than a simple “one-size” fee, because transaction history quality and complexity can vary widely.
Emergency pricing: Not publicly stated. Some firms may offer accelerated timelines (for deadlines or urgent documentation needs), but this is typically handled case-by-case.
What affects cost: crypto tax engagements often become expensive when the advisor must reconstruct records from multiple sources or correct inconsistent data. If you can provide clean exports and wallet addresses upfront, you can reduce billable time.
Key cost factors to expect:
- Transaction volume: number of trades, transfers, swaps, deposits/withdrawals
- Data sources: number of exchanges, wallets, and chains used
- Complex activity: DeFi lending/borrowing, liquidity pools, bridging, NFTs
- Record quality: missing exports, inconsistent timestamps, unknown cost basis
- Scope of deliverables: tax summary only vs. full reconciliation + filing support
- Time sensitivity: shortened deadlines, urgent bank or audit requests

Can a regular accountant handle cryptocurrency taxes?
Sometimes, yes—especially for simple buy/sell activity with clean records. For complex cases (multiple wallets, DeFi, staking/mining), you’ll want an advisor who is comfortable tracing transactions and explaining classifications clearly.
What documents should I prepare before contacting a Cryptocurrency Tax Advisor?
Prepare exchange CSV exports, wallet addresses, transaction history screenshots if needed, bank statements showing fiat on/off ramps, and notes about unusual events (lost access, hacks, airdrops, staking rewards). Also list which platforms you used.
Do I need to provide wallet addresses?
Often yes, if the advisor is reconciling activity across wallets and exchanges. If you have privacy concerns, ask how data is handled, what is retained, and whether you can limit scope to exchange-only records (if applicable).

What if my crypto records are incomplete?
A competent advisor should be able to outline reconstruction steps (requesting missing exports, using wallet history, matching deposits/withdrawals). Expect the work to take longer and potentially cost more when data gaps are significant.
